Background On Retirement Income Planning

Retirement income planning is super essential for financial health. It involves strategizing, investments, and risk assessment for a steady income after retirement.

Regarding retirement income planning, there are various factors to consider. Desired lifestyles, expenses, inflation rates, and life expectancy are all important. With this info, you can develop plans and portfolios which match your goals.

Social security benefits are essential too. Knowing the criteria and timing of claiming these benefits is vital. This can impact your financial situation later in life.

Fluctuating Economic Conditions

Market volatility? Fluctuations in the stock market can alter retirement investments, causing changes in portfolio values. Inflation risk? Prices rise, eroding the purchasing power of retirement savings. Interest rate fluctuations? Changes in interest rates impact investment returns, especially for fixed-income assets like bonds or annuities. Uncertain job market? Economic downturns can lead to job loss and reduced earning potential. Tax policy changes? Alterations in tax laws and regulations can affect retirees’ income and tax liabilities. Global economic events? Recessions or geopolitical tensions can disrupt markets and economies worldwide, impacting retirement plans.

Despite these challenges, adjustments can be made to mitigate their effect. Diversifying investments, reviewing financial strategies, and seeking professional advice are effective ways to navigate fluctuating economic conditions when planning for retirement. Diversifying Income Sources

  • Investing in rental properties can provide a steady income stream.
  • Dividend-paying stocks can generate regular income after retirement.
  • Bonds offer interest payments, providing stability and security.
  • Annuities guarantee periodic payments, making them a reliable retirement source.
  • Social Security benefits are essential for retirees to supplement their income.
  • Part-time work or freelancing can add extra income while maintaining flexibility.

Retirees can reduce reliance on a single financial avenue by diversifying income sources. Mitigate risks associated with market fluctuations and economic uncertainties.

Overreliance On Social Security Benefits

Martha’s story serves as a reminder to plan for retirement. She relied solely on social security, and when government policies changed, her benefits were reduced. Now, she struggles with expenses in her later years.

Retirees should be aware that social security is subject to changes, and depending only on these benefits can be risky. Social security may not be enough to cover all costs. Therefore, diversifying income sources is essential.

Options such as personal savings, investments, and other forms of supplemental income should be explored. This way, individuals can reduce their reliance on any single source and protect themselves from potential reductions or adjustments in their income.

Online Retirement Calculators

Online retirement calculators provide features to help individuals adjust their plans. For instance, some let the user alter the rate of return on investments or add in Social Security benefits. This allows them to see how different options impact their retirement.

These tools can also aid with investment strategies. They may suggest asset allocations based on a person’s risk tolerance and time horizon. This can be helpful for those seeking to maximize their returns.

One should gather up-to-date information like income, savings, debts, and expenses to make the most of online retirement calculators. This will give accurate projections. Also, updating inputs regularly will show progress toward retirement goals.
